This review is from: Mark Schultz (Audio CD)
This album is the absolute best!!!!! Certainly one of my favorites!!!!!!!1. "I Am The Way" 10/10. A great uplifting song about how you can rely on God and how He can lead you. 2. "Let's Go" 9/10. Pretty good. All about finding yourself and God. 3. "He's My Son" 11/10! A beautiful sad song written from the point of view of the father of a child with leukemia. Mmmm...it made me cry. So sad, so lovely . . . 4. "When You Come Home" 10/10. Another slower song about the relationship between mother and son, mixing heaven in the middle. Lovely. I played Tracks 3 and 4 for my mother when she was cooking dinner, and the meal was a tad salty because she was crying by the end of the two. 5. "When You Give" 10/10. Back to the upbeat songs. This one's all about how God doesn't care what color a person is. Really fun with the whole ~Take Me To The River~ parts toward the end. 6. "Fall In Love Again" 7/10. Not my favorite, I usually skip it. Still, it's pretty enough. 7. "Cloud Of Witnesses" 10/10. Back to a somewhat slower song about watching children grow and how God watches and cares for us. Lovely. A favorite of mine. Makes me want to be a teacher. 8. "Learn To Let Go" 9/10. A pretty, slower song about a father who's remembering how his child grew up. Makes me think of the songs a father and daughter dance to when she's gotten married. 9. "I Saw The Light" 9/10. Cool, kinda funky. A jamaican sort-of beat. An upbeat Amazing Grace part filters through. Fun. 10. "Legend Of McBride" 10/10. About a peaceful authority figure who saves a child from a fire, sacrificing his life for the baby's. Fun. 11. "Remember Me" 10/10. Mmmm, beautiful slow song telling people to remember me/him/whoever and asking that Jesus remember him. Lovely. All in all, this is definitly one of my favorite albums. Great soulful, comforting music. I always come out of hearing Mark Schultz feeling good. He has a gift. This isn't Christian rock or punk, but it's still good. It's kinda like Steven Curtis Chapman.
